Subject: Quickstore 4.2 — bloom filter now fronts the KV layer

Plugin authors: starting with this release, Quickstore places a bloom filter ahead of the key-value store. Negative lookups return faster; false positives fall through safely. No API changes are required on your side. Verify your plugin against the staging build referenced below.

session token of fahif-tadup = htk3_9c7

## Deployment

Welcome aboard! WaveGlimpse renders those little audio waveform previews you see in the Tonefold uploader. Deploys are boring on purpose: one worker container, one rendering queue, no sidecar nonsense. Build the image, tag it with the sprint number, and the pipeline handles rollout to the Merrow cluster. The renderer won't start without its config — peak sampling rate, preview width, cache TTL, the works — so double-check it before you hit deploy. These are the values we're running right now.

deployment values, yadup-kadug:
[sorys]
port = 5672
team = noveth
host = sorys.orvexcorp.example
region = south-4
access_code = ac_deddc1
timeout_ms = 1500

Leadership Review Briefing — Pallasgrove Tech. Heads of department: quick heads-up before Thursday. We're weighing a move of after-hours support to Corven Desk, an outsourcing shop out of Merrow Bay. Pilot numbers look decent — faster response, mixed CSAT. Cost savings are real but not huge. Come ready to argue either way. The strategic reasoning sits in the confidential note below.

confidential, kagup-bafog: Fraaxax Group is in early talks to buy Soroxox Group for about $343.8 million. The Olidor launch date is June 14, and nothing goes to the press before then. Legal wants the Aldmirek Logistics term sheet signed before July 23.